"I wanted to try the 'Gakemi's Cold Noodles' so much. It was a limited menu item, and the soup made with corn juice and salt only was getting a lot of attention. I was a little late. It's already sold out. So, let's try another limited menu item that caught my eye... Let's have the 'Aikotomato Vegan Cold Noodles'. The signature menu 'Veggie Soba' is already a unique item, but this one is amazing too. It's like a flood of tomatoes. A delightful scream. The tomato soup is really delicious. It's not just on the screen. I feel like I'm drowning in tomatoes. A refreshing and sweet tomato soup. It surprisingly gives a sense of satisfaction. Among the mountain of fresh tomatoes, there are also some dried tomatoes scattered around. They make a good broth. Watercress is served, and the topping that looks like bulgur wheat is probably rice puffs. It's mixed with basil paste. It smells nice. The one that looks like cream cheese is probably tofu paste, right? It has a texture like chickpea hummus. The visual presentation is incredibly mysterious, but the taste and aroma are well-balanced. The noodles are firm and have a good volume. It was satisfying. It's not just healthy. There is a sense of fulfillment. The restaurant also offers a variety of unique ramen dishes. The idea of trying lamb in Genghis Khan ramen sounds interesting too. The restaurant keeps coming up with endless ideas. I was overwhelmed."

Arrived on a Wednesday weekday at 7:02 PM, there were 11 people ahead. Purchased food tickets in advance and got seated at 7:10 PM. Received my Tsukemen at 7:26 PM, which cost 1,000 yen. It seems like you need to buy the food tickets in advance, but there weren't clear instructions like in other stores. It might be okay to go to the ticket machine while waiting in line. I decided to try the Tsukemen, which is only available from 2 PM on weekdays (3 PM on weekends and holidays). The noodles were made with "Haru yo koi" and were medium-thick and chewy. The soup had chunks of chashu and thick menma, with a sharp soy sauce flavor. Squeezing lemon over the noodles and mixing it in added a refreshing taste. I would like to try their soy sauce ramen next time. It was like eating udon, so it was a neutral experience! Thank you for the meal.

This shop located in Ramen Street inside Tokyo Station has the following features: 1) Selected as one of the top 5000 restaurants on Tabelog, showcasing its true skills. 2) Their light soy sauce ramen is made with soy sauce aged in wooden barrels, Japan's largest free-range chicken "Amakusa Daio," and "π water" that brings out the flavors of the ingredients, all combined with the unprecedented beauty and taste of their "Kinto-un" noodles. They are committed to using top-quality ingredients. 3) In addition to their light soy sauce ramen, they also offer "Goku" tsukemen and Veggie Soba as their main dishes, catering to various dietary restrictions such as allergies, gluten-free, guilt-free, and vegan. They lineup a heartfelt bowl that focuses on "ingredients, nutrition, and taste." This is a recommended shop for those returning from a trip.
